Title: Eng P Chang: Innovator in Flame Retardant Nylon Compositions
Introduction
Eng P Chang is a notable inventor based in Grand Island, NY (US). She has made significant contributions to the field of materials science, particularly in the development of flame retardant nylon compositions. Her innovative work has led to advancements in the physical properties and molding characteristics of nylon materials.
Latest Patents
Eng P Chang holds a patent for flame retardant nylon compositions. This patent describes a mixture that includes about 45 to about 70 weight percent of nylon 6 or nylon 66, or a mixture thereof. Additionally, it comprises about 15 to about 25 percent of nylon 612, about 2 to about 10 percent of iron oxide, antimony oxide, or zinc oxide, and about 10 to about 25 percent of bis(hexachlorocyclopentadieno)cyclooctane. This innovative composition enhances the safety and performance of nylon products.
Career Highlights
Eng P Chang is associated with Hooker Chemicals & Plastics Corporation, where she has applied her expertise in materials development. Her work has been instrumental in creating safer and more effective nylon products for various applications.
Collaborations
Eng P Chang has collaborated with notable colleagues, including Charles S Ilardo and Eugene L Slagowski. These partnerships have contributed to the advancement of her research and the successful development of her patented innovations.
